在使用 数组 时,有时需要递增地给数组中每个元素赋值。
此时使用iota()函数就十分方便。
函数定义
对起点first
到终点last
的整数(均为指针类型)进行递增 +1的赋值。
需引入头文件:
#include
格式:
iota(array, array+length[array], number);
从number开始,分别为数组array数组中各元素递增+1地赋值。
vector p(n);
iota(p.begin(), p.end(), 0);
从number开始,分别为数组vector容器中各元素递增+1地赋值。